Key Takeaways from The Life Plan

  1. Aging reversal is achievable through disciplined exercise, nutrition, and hormone optimization.
  2. Combat sarcopenia with targeted resistance training and optimized protein intake.
  3. Low-glycemic diets reduce inflammation and sustain energy for muscle preservation.
  4. Hormone therapy combined with natural supplements counteracts age-related decline.
  5. Multidisciplinary exercise plans improve cardiovascular health and prevent muscle loss.
  6. Customizable meal plans adapt to heart health or fat-loss goals.
  7. Regular health monitoring via bloodwork catches early aging biomarkers.
  8. Sleep optimization and stress management are critical for hormonal balance.
  9. Strategic nutrient timing maximizes muscle growth and fat burning.
  10. Proactive aging strategies reduce diabetes and heart disease risks.
  11. Jeffry Life’s 59-year-old transformation proves aging isn’t inevitable.
  12. Consistent adherence to The Life Plan ensures lifelong fitness and sexual vitality.

Overview of its author - Jeffry S. Life

Jeffry S. Life, M.D., Ph.D., is the New York Times bestselling author of The Life Plan and a leading authority in men’s health and anti-aging medicine. A board-certified physician specializing in hormone replacement therapy and preventive care, Life draws from his transformative personal journey—documented in The Life Plan—to help men revitalize physical performance, sexual health, and longevity through integrated exercise, nutrition, and medical protocols.

His sequel, Mastering the Life Plan, expands these evidence-based strategies for lifelong wellness.

Life’s expertise has been featured on The Doctors, Steve Harvey, and The Dr. Phil Show, while Men’s Fitness recognized him among the world’s fittest men at age 75. Through his Las Vegas-based practice and platform DrLife.com, he continues to empower patients worldwide.

Common FAQs of The Life Plan

What is The Life Plan by Jeffry S. Life about?

The Life Plan outlines a comprehensive health program for men to combat aging through exercise, nutrition, supplements, and hormone optimization. Dr. Jeffry S. Life, a physician who transformed his own health in his 60s, emphasizes preventive care, muscle retention, and sexual vitality. The book includes meal plans, workout routines, and hormone therapy guidance tailored to reverse age-related decline.

Who should read The Life Plan?

Men over 40 seeking to improve fitness, sexual health, and longevity will benefit most. It’s ideal for those struggling with weight gain, low energy, or hormone imbalances. The program is customizable for all fitness levels, making it relevant for beginners and health-conscious individuals aiming to avoid age-related diseases.

Is The Life Plan worth reading?

Yes, particularly for men prioritizing actionable steps over theoretical advice. Dr. Life’s firsthand success—achieving a lean physique and reversing metabolic issues in his 60s—adds credibility. The book’s structured approach to diet, exercise, and hormone optimization provides clear, science-backed methods for sustained results.

How does The Life Plan approach aging?

The program combats aging by targeting four pillars: strength training, anti-inflammatory nutrition, targeted supplements (like omega-3s and vitamin D), and bioidentical hormone replacement. Dr. Life argues these strategies slow muscle loss, boost cognitive function, and restore sexual vitality, calling it a "new paradigm" for male health.

What diet does The Life Plan recommend?

It promotes a high-protein, low-glycemic diet with lean meats, vegetables, and healthy fats to reduce inflammation and stabilize blood sugar. The plan includes recipes, portion guidelines, and tips for dining out. Dr. Life stresses meal prep as critical to avoiding dietary "failure".

Does The Life Plan discuss hormone replacement therapy (HRT)?

Yes, it advocates personalized HRT (including testosterone and growth hormone) for men with diagnosed deficiencies. Dr. Life shares his own use of HGH but acknowledges debates about cancer risks, advising readers to seek medical supervision. The book provides hormone lab ranges and protocols for optimization.

What exercises are emphasized in The Life Plan?

The program combines resistance training (3–4 weekly sessions) with cardio (interval and steady-state) to build muscle and improve heart health. Exercises target major muscle groups, with modifications for all fitness levels. Dr. Life credits this regimen for his dramatic physique transformation.

How does The Life Plan differ from other men’s health books?

Unlike generic advice, it integrates clinical insights from Dr. Life’s medical practice and personal journey. The focus on hormone testing, customized supplementation, and long-term maintenance sets it apart. It also addresses sexual health and mental resilience alongside physical fitness.

Are there success stories in The Life Plan?

Dr. Life references patient case studies showing improved cholesterol, muscle mass, and libido. His own story—losing 50 pounds, regaining energy, and reversing prediabetes—serves as the primary example. The follow-up book Mastering the Life Plan expands on these testimonials.

What are criticisms of The Life Plan?

Some experts caution against self-administered hormone therapies without medical oversight, citing cancer risks from unregulated HGH use. The diet’s strictness may also challenge those with hectic schedules. Critics argue the program’s intensity might deter casual readers.

How does The Life Plan address sexual health?

It links sexual vitality to hormone balance, cardiovascular health, and muscle strength. The book provides strategies for improving erectile function through targeted exercises (like Kegels), nitric oxide boosters, and testosterone optimization. Dr. Life frames sexual health as a key marker of overall wellness.

Can The Life Plan be customized for individual needs?

Yes, Dr. Life encourages adapting meal portions, workout intensity, and hormone protocols based on age, health status, and goals. Mastering the Life Plan (his follow-up book) offers simplified frameworks for tailoring the program long-term.
